I have done experiments on flow visualization of impinging flow on the wall with a great swirl velocity.

In detail, I set up a test rig with 3cm diameter fan for cpu cooling and a transparent flat plate under the fan to take a picture. At first, I make smoke by burning paraffin with somke generator and I direct smoke with tube to the fan inlet. I can see some smokes after fan outlet but hardly I can take pictures of smoke after fan inlet. I think the strength of wind id too string enought to see the somke with eyes or by taking pictures.

So, I wanna know the method for flow visualization.. of micro cooling fan for PC processor, without any special apparatus..I have only a smoke generator, a camera and a camcoder. The velocity of flow is 1[m/s] so it is too low for usual flow visualization methods.
